Regular Maintenance Checks

One of the most important ways to protect your truck is by performing regular maintenance checks. This includes checking the oil levels, tire pressure, brakes, and other essential components. By regularly maintaining your truck, you can catch any issues early on and prevent them from turning into major problems down the line. Additionally, following the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ule can help prolong the lifespan of your truck and ensure it continues to operate smoothly.

Invest in Quality Truck Accessories

Another way to protect your truck is by investing in quality accessories that can enhance its functionality and appearance. This includes items such as bed liners, tonneau covers, and running boards, which can help protect your truck from scratches, dents, and other damage. Additionally, accessories like mud flaps and fender flares can help guard your truck against dirt, debris, and other environmental factors that can cause wear and tear.

Secure Your Truck

Protecting your truck from theft is another important aspect of Truck protection. By investing in security measures such as alarm systems, steering wheel locks, and GPS tracking devices, you can deter potential thieves and safeguard your vehicle. Parking your truck in well-lit areas or secure garages can also help reduce the risk of theft and vandalism. Additionally, installing a secure tool kit box in your truck bed can help protect your valuable equipment and tools from being stolen.

Clean and Detail Your Truck Regularly

Regularly cleaning and detailing your truck is not only important for aesthetics but also for protection. Dirt, grime, and other contaminants can cause corrosion and rust on your truck’s exterior, leading to costly repairs. By washing and waxing your truck regularly, you can maintain its finish and protect it from environmental factors such as UV rays, salt, and pollution. Interior detailing is also crucial for preserving the condition of your truck’s upholstery, dashboard, and other surfaces.

Drive Safely and Responsibly

One of the best ways to protect your truck is by driving safely and responsibly. Avoiding aggressive driving behaviors such as speeding, sudden braking, and harsh acceleration can help prevent accidents and damage to your vehicle. By following traffic laws, obeying speed limits, and practicing defensive driving techniques, you can minimize the risk of collisions and keep your truck safe on the road. Additionally, avoiding off-road driving and rough terrain can help prevent damage to your truck’s suspension, tires, and other components.

Consider Protective Coatings

Applying protective coatings such as paint sealants, ceramic coatings, and rust inhibitors can provide an extra layer of protection for your truck’s exterior. These coatings can help repel water, dirt, and other contaminants, making it easier to clean and maintain your truck. Additionally, rust inhibitors can help prevent corrosion and extend the lifespan of your truck’s metal surfaces. Investing in these protective coatings can help keep your truck looking shiny and new for years to come.
